If you can swing it, get it coated. Otherwise, make sure you wrap the header and wrap the wrap in something water-resistant; trapping water against the header will rust it over time.

You can wrap your entire exhaust, but that might be excessive...

I did it before I installed it. I used about 70-80 feet of wrap to do both. I used high temp paint for headers. I spryed them after I wrapped them too. That should keep the water out and protect the wrap.
